    I tried to log in to the game from steam and after waiting for the update to finish, I get this message and now am unable to load the game at all.

    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
    Steam - Error

    An error occurred while updating Shroud of the Avatar : Forsaken Virtues (content file locked):

    C:\Program Files (x86)\steam\steamapps\common\SotA\Shroud of the Avatar.exe

    -----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------


    I restarted my computer a couple of times and even completely uninstalled the game and reinstalled it but always get this Steam pop up message when I try to start the game.

    I have been a daily player for the last 2 weeks with no problems at all (until now).

    Please help and Thank you.

    ~Loki~


    EDIT: I have since solved this problem after hours of frustration, Purely a fault with Steam and I was able to fix it by uninstalling Steam completely and then re-installing Steam and then re-installing SotA. Cheers.

    If it happens again try clearing cache on steam - it may not have solved your issue but if a file gets corrupted during installation it can usually fix it.

    1. Restart your computer and launch Steam.
    2. From the Library section, right-click on the game and select Properties from the menu.
    3. Select the Local files tab and click the Verify integrity of game files... button.
    4. Steam will verify the game's files - this process may take several minutes.
